Output 024c68e4b4500051ce91d590b21f6330a707bfa2028e448749764c6cd4ebb77e:4

value
4135562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eee3a4ce55f656697e50669ad053618db2f0ed3 OP_EQUAL
address
3GBN5Cv1K3KRQEshZUJZsnp3EzhFdtpFU8
transaction
024c68e4b4500051ce91d590b21f6330a707bfa2028e448749764c6cd4ebb77e
spent
true